Business Context and Reporting Period
Company: Canadian Imperial Bank of Commerce (CIBC)
Filing Type: Form 6-K (Report of Foreign Private Issuer)
Reporting Period: September 2024 (Specific date: September 6, 2024)
Context: This filing serves as a notification of a corporate action regarding share repurchases rather than a periodic financial report.
Key Financial Metrics
The filing text does not provide specific values for revenue, profit, cash flow, margins, debt, or liquidity. This document is a procedural filing to disclose a regulatory approval and does not contain financial statements.
Material Changes
Share Repurchase Program: CIBC received approval from the Toronto Stock Exchange (TSX) to commence a Normal Course Issuer Bid (NCIB). This allows the bank to repurchase its own shares in the open market.
Guidance, Outlook, and Risks
Management Commentary: The filing references a news release dated September 6, 2024, detailing the NCIB approval. No specific financial guidance, outlook, or risk factors are detailed within the text of this specific Form 6-K.
